Transaction e25076c915e4ccdaba48fe694e93367a43ab93c902877761c33e917d3c6f4604

block
5b8aee9829b7adb4d768e67d17c41ad89134fcdcca8e10db92a1318da9e4d87d

2 Inputs

2 Outputs